**Q: Why do customers see brief freezes in MatchRite during peak hours?**

A: MatchRite's matching engine runs on a managed runtime, and under heavy order flow the garbage collector occasionally performs a full compaction pause of 200–400 ms. Orders are never lost — they queue and process once the pause ends — but latency-sensitive clients may report timeouts. The Saltmere team tuned heap regions in release 8.3, which reduced pause frequency considerably. For current pause thresholds, tuning flags, and the escalation path, consult this page:

operations page: https://jenkins.zemvarcloud.local/job/merge_requests/repo/build/73930b4b30f0a8ed

### Incremental Rebuild Thresholds

The Tarnstead site generator rebuilds only pages whose content hash changed, plus any page within the dependency radius. Future maintainers should note that the radius and batch limits were chosen to keep rebuilds under the deploy window, not for elegance. Adjust cautiously and re-measure. The governing constants appear below.

limits module of kagep-kagug:
QUOTAS = {
    "wenael": 10,
    "wenwyn": 2,
}

Memo — Warranty Cost Overrun. For the incoming director: warranty claims on the Solvane K2 line ran 38% above provision this year, driven by a connector fault in units built at the Ferndale plant. Total overrun: 910k. Supplier Qualtren has accepted partial liability; recovery talks continue. A revised provisioning model takes effect next quarter. Field repair capacity has been doubled temporarily. The remediation and product-line plan is set out below.

confidential, kagep-kahof: Druokax Systems plans to lower the Ulaath list price by 53 percent in March.